Overview
The AMIS30511C5112RG is a fully integrated bipolar stepper motor driver and controller manufactured by onsemi. It operates within a supply voltage range of 6V to 30V and is housed in a 24-SOIC package. The device combines control logic with power stages, eliminating the need for external drivers.

Part Context
This IC belongs to the AMIS305xx family of motor drivers designed for automotive and industrial environments. It provides a complete drive solution for bipolar stepper motors, integrating necessary control functions and power output stages into a single package for space-constrained designs.
